2012-02-07 3 views
8

Я пытаюсь клонировать репозиторий TFS с помощью git-tfs.git-tfs: Как клонировать проект tfs, содержащий пробелы

Он отлично работает с проектами TFS, что уже не надо пробел в имени, например:

git tfs clone http://tfs:8080/ $/TeamProject/folder 

Но у меня есть несколько проектов/папки, которые имеют оба пространство и шведские символы в нем:

git tfs clone http://tfs:8080/ $/TeamProject/my swedish åäö folder1/folder2 

Когда я запускаю команду я получаю:

The item $/TeamProject/my swedish åäö folder1/folder2 does not exist at the spcified version. 

Любое предложение, как это исправить?

+5

Try охватывающего весь путь в двойных кавычках. – Polynomial

+0

Это работало частично. Теперь я могу клонировать проекты/папки с пространством, но все еще имею проблемы с swedish-символами. – Zeno

+1

Вы могли бы попытаться присвоить их? Я не уверен, как он обрабатывает такие символы. – Polynomial

ответ

5

Я решил проблему, переименовав проекты в TFS и удалив шведские символы.

Как сказал Polynomial, возможно иметь папки/проекты, которые содержат пространство, если вы заключите путь с двойными кавычками.

+1

да двойная кавычка должна сохранять вас за пробелы, но последняя версия git-tfs теперь должна решить вашу проблему с шведскими символами ... – Philippe

10

Вот рабочий пример клонирования (TFVC) хранилище TFS, используя git tfs где (TFVC) хранилище TFS содержит пробелы:

git tfs clone http://tfs:8080/ $/"Team Project/Folder Name"

Ключ «трюк», чтобы сделать его работу будет ставить двойные кавычки вокруг имени проекта команды/папки (но не помещайте их вокруг части $/).

т.е. $/"Team Project/Folder Name"

+0

Ваш ответ не имеет смысла. Можете ли вы вспомнить (и добавить) контекст? – jpaugh

+0

Как это не имеет смысла? Первоначальный вопрос: «Как клонировать проект tfs, который содержит пробелы», и я привел пример клонирования проекта tfs, который содержит пробелы, например. '$ /" Team Project/имя папки "'. –

+0

В вашем ответе не упоминается, что случилось, или даже есть ли способ исправить это. (Это, по сути, «Кое-что о цитатах».) Это может показаться странным, но установление * достоверности * столь же важно, как наличие правильного кода. – jpaugh

 Смежные вопросы

  • Нет связанных вопросов^_^